Abstract: Tennant Golds Noble Nob Projects comprise a total of 32 mining leases covering 261.8 hectares at Nobles Nob. The Nobles Nob deposit was previously exploited as an underground mine between 1947 and 1965 and subsequently as an open pit from 1967 to 1984. In total, the Nobles Nob and surrounding deposits produced 1.17 million ounces of gold at 17 g/t. During the 2016 reporting period Excalibur Mining was the operator of the Tennant Gold project area. Excalibur underwent a company restructure and towards the end of the reporting period relinquished there rights over the Nobles Nob project. Due the restructuring process of Excalibur, no activities were carried out. Tennant Gold believes that the Nobles Nob project is still a highly prospective site for gold mineralisation.
